
Collision between 2 Delta planes at LaGuardia Airport.
Two Delta Air Lines planes collided while taxiing at LaGuardia Airport in New York, resulting in one flight attendant being injured and passengers having to disembark. Initial reports from Delta indicated that the wing of Endeavor Flight 5155, preparing to depart for Roanoke, Virginia, struck the nose of Endeavor Flight 5047, which had just arrived from Charlotte, North Carolina. Delta referred to the incident as a “low-speed collision” and confirmed that the injured flight attendant received treatment at the scene before being taken to a hospital. Both flights were carrying passengers, who were safely removed from the planes and provided with transportation back to the terminal. Passengers were also given accommodations, meals, and options for rebooking on the following day. Delta apologized for the incident and assured that safety is a top priority. The cause of the collision is under investigation.
